Lympstone Village may not boast a plethora of high-tech facilities, but it provides the essentials for a comfortable journey. Although there is no ticket office, tickets can be purchased online before arrival. For those who rely on digital solutions, it's worth noting that there are no ticket machines available. Walking through the station, you'll find that it provides step-free access to some parts, which is helpful for travelers with mobility concerns.
The station doesn’t have lounges or waiting rooms but does offer seating areas where you can rest while waiting for your train. For anyone requiring assistance, the station has a help point that provides vital information, ensuring you're supported during your journey. In terms of safety and security, there is no CCTV on site, so it’s prudent to remain vigilant with your belongings.
If you're planning to explore further afield, Lympstone Village station is your springboard to numerous locations. Though there is no direct taxi service at the station, you can plan your journey with local bus links for onward travel. Be sure to check the onward travel poster for complete bus service details and other transport connections. If you've ever wondered about bike hire, the station doesn't have services onsite, but bike stands are available for those who cycle to the station.

Ockendon Station, managed by c2c, offers an array of amenities to ensure passenger comfort and convenience.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 11:05 on weekdays, and 08:55 to 13:30 on Saturdays. The station is equipped with ticket machines, including accessible ones, for easy collection of tickets purchased online. Smartcard validators are present, though smartcards aren’t issued here.
Accessibility is a priority with features such as step-free access, though it’s limited to platform 1. Acc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and a ramp for train access are also available. There are accessible toilets on Platform 1, which require a RADAR key. However, facilities like refreshment outlets, ATMs, and baby changing rooms are not available at this station.
For onward travel, Ockendon Station offers several transportation links. In case of rail disruptions, replacement buses operate from the bus stop outside the station, and there’s an arrangement for ticket acceptance on the TfL 370 Bus to Lakeside and Romford. Conveniently, taxis are available for hire, helping you reach your destination effortlessly. For those who prefer a bus journey, planning your trip is made easy with printable information available here.
